Transaction 59e789395143c32cbae291fd230a13df480e785ec6cff4618ff9f86418d4afee
1 Input
1 Output
-
59e789395143c32cbae291fd230a13df480e785ec6cff4618ff9f86418d4afee:0
- value
- 117888
- script pubkey
- OP_0 OP_PUSHBYTES_32 a342ad08ed495e70458058ea5e1eb8fbe018e08209fe87a05a28d3148065b7fc
- address
- bc1q5dp26z8df908q3vqtr49u84cl0sp3cyzp8lg0gz69rf3fqr9kl7qp40tf5